Griffins' Kosar named AHL Player of the Week TheAHL.com

Springfield, Massachusetts …National Hockey League announces Grand Rapids Griffins goaltender today Sebastian Cosa has been selected as Howies Hockey Video/AHL Player of the Week Period ending November 30, 2025.

Kosar allowed just four goals on 73 shots last week (1.33, .945) as the league-leading Griffins won three straight.

Kosar helped lead Grand Rapids to a 10-1 two-game sweep over Texas State on Tuesday and made 24 saves in a 6-3 victory over Grand Rapids on Wednesday. Then on Sunday night, Kosar earned his second shutout of the season by stopping all 26 shots he faced in the Griffins' 1-0 victory over visiting Iowa.

Kosar, Detroit's first-round pick (15th overall) in the 2021 NHL Draft, is 8-1-0 in nine starts this season and leads the AHL in goals against average (1.56) and save percentage (0.942). The 23-year-old from Hamilton, Ont., has made 93 career appearances for Grand Rapids, compiling a 52-26-14 record, a 2.43 GAA, a .912 save percentage and five shutouts. Kosar has played one game for the Red Wings and earned a win in his NHL debut on December 9, 2024 in Buffalo.
